A flash flood claimed at least four lives in Turkey’s Black Sea region, the interior minister said on Wednesday, APA reports.

Speaking to reporters about the flood in Arakli in the Trabzon province, Suleyman Soylu said rescue teams are trying to reach at least six other people.

"Search and rescue teams of 280, including Turkey’s Disaster and Emergency Management Presidency (AFAD), Search and Rescue Association (AKUT), and gendarmerie forces are searching the region," Soylu added.

The flood demolished seven buildings, he added.

Earlier, Agriculture and Forest Minister Bekir Pakdemirli denied reports saying the flood was caused by a hydroelectric power plant pipe explosion.

"The flood was caused by a landslide," he said.
